Output 13b8aea0b8bd2650623912567e4a614fe00651e0004ced743774e1d8abe27676:0

value
644351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38cfa0e3f0530af9024515704eeaf4098401b317 OP_EQUALVERIFY OP_CHECKSIG
address
16BPa2HF1mA1ksR7SCMzGbMq55FkUBR8hA
transaction
13b8aea0b8bd2650623912567e4a614fe00651e0004ced743774e1d8abe27676
spent
true